Abstract :
A glass ampoule of water 10 cm3 in volume has been brought down to and maintained at a temperature of −30°C in the liquid state, and its heat capacity has been measured between −28.5°C and +10°C. The experimental data show an anomalous behaviour of the heat capacity of water in the supercooled regime, more pronounced than that previously observed from experiments on water emulsions.
